YEAR 6 HOMEWORK SCHEDULE 2021-22
Your child will receive weekly homework tasks which can be found on Seesaw. Instructions will be given with each task.
This will include:
1. Reading on a daily basis for at least 10-15 minutes. Please ensure you ask your child 2 or 3 questions about the text or ask them to summarise what they have been reading. Record any comments in the Reading Record Book, as it is a useful means of communication between home and school.
2. Spelling homework is set on a Monday to be completed by Friday.
3. English and maths homework is set on alternating weeks. These are set on a Thursday to be completed by the following Tuesday.
4. Maths homework will be on Seesaw.
5. Cornerstones – at the beginning of each half term we will provide the children with ideas for their cornerstones homework. This is shared on Seesaw. These are a wonderful chance to be creative!
